Aluminium Alloy 5754 Sheet is a popular aluminium grade known for its exceptional corrosion resistance, medium strength, and excellent weldability. It is widely used in industries such as marine, automotive, and construction due to its ability to perform well in harsh environments. Aluminium Alloy 5754 belongs to the 5000 series of aluminium-magnesium alloys. It is a non-heat-treatable alloy that achieves its strength through strain hardening. Its high magnesium content gives it superior resistance to seawater, making it ideal for marine environments and offshore structures.
This alloy also exhibits excellent surface finishing properties, making it suitable for decorative and architectural applications where both appearance and performance matter.
| Element | Percentage (%) |
|---|---|
| Aluminium (Al) | Balance |
| Magnesium (Mg) | 2.6 – 3.6 |
| Manganese (Mn) | 0.4 – 1.0 |
| Iron (Fe) | 0.4 max |
| Silicon (Si) | 0.4 max |
| Chromium (Cr) | 0.3 max |
| Others | 0.15 max |
This precise composition ensures good mechanical strength and excellent corrosion resistance, particularly against saltwater and industrial atmospheres.
Excellent Corrosion Resistance: Performs exceptionally well in marine and coastal conditions.
Good Weldability: Compatible with all conventional welding methods.
High Strength Compared to 5005 and 5052: Offers moderate strength suitable for structural applications.
Excellent Formability: Easily shaped, bent, or rolled without cracking.
Good Surface Finish: Can be anodized or polished for a clean and aesthetic look.
Thanks to its corrosion resistance and durability, Aluminium 5754 Sheet is widely used in:
Marine Industry: Shipbuilding, boat hulls, decks, and gangways.
Automotive Sector: Body panels, fuel tanks, and truck bodies.
Construction Industry: Roofing, cladding, and decorative panels.
Food Processing: Storage tanks, kitchen equipment, and containers.
Transportation: Rail cars, road tankers, and pressure vessels.
Aluminium 5754 Sheets are typically available in the following tempers:
O (Soft Annealed) – For maximum formability.
H111, H22, H24, H32 – For increased strength through strain hardening.
